Ticket #— Floor 9 Opening Prep, Brindlemoor House

Hi facilities folks, Floor 9 opens to staff next Monday and we need a few things squared away before then. Lift access is live, but the two side doors by the kitchenette are still on the old lock config — please reprogram them before Friday. Also, signage for the quiet rooms hasn't arrived, so pop up the temporary printed ones for now. Until the badge readers sync, the interim door code for Floor 9 is below.

door code, bajop-bajog: bdg-DSWAC-43621

**Action item from the Pondglass incident (autoscaler thrash)**

Quick recap for reviewers: the queue-depth autoscaler flapped because our scale-up and scale-down thresholds were too close together, and the evaluation window was short enough that a single burst triggered both directions within two minutes. This PR widens the hysteresis band, lengthens the window, and adds a cooldown after any scaling action. Nothing clever here — just saner defaults. Please sanity-check the math against last week's graphs. The new constants are below.

tuning constants:
QUOTAS = {
    "druwyn": 5,
    "holix": 5,
    "zorath": 5,
    "holwyn": 10,
}

Runbook fragment — recalled chargers. So, the pallet of Voltbee chargers flagged in the recall is shrink-wrapped in the loading bay, red tape on all sides. Nobody touches it, nobody borrows "just one" — they're going back to the Kestrel Point depot for destruction. A courier truck from Bramblehaul is booked for Tuesday. Sign the manifest, keep a copy, and that's it. At pick-up, give the driver this instruction:

handover note for yagef-bagep: the drudor pelius courier leaves the kasdor zorvan norir ledger at gate 8016 under passcode 755406

### Step 4 — Cut over the import wizard

At this point you've drained the old Sheetfeed queue, so the CSV import wizard can be pointed at the new parser cluster. Don't skip the dry-run: kick off a sample import from the Larchmont test tenant and confirm row counts match before flipping the flag. If anything looks off, page the Sheetfeed owner rather than reverting yourself — rollback touches three services. Once the dry-run passes, apply the cutover settings, which are the following.

settings of tagef-bawif:
DRUIX_HOST=druix.zemvarlabs.internal
DRUIX_PORT=8000